Origins and Gameplay:
Roulette, a casino online game that originated in France throughout the 18th century, quickly became a well liked among gamblers. With all the development of technology plus the rise of online gambling systems, this centuries-old game changed into its virtual form, called web roulette. The game play of on the web roulette stays faithful to its standard counterpart, featuring a spinning wheel and a betting table. Players spot their bets on various figures, colors, or combinations, and wait for the wheel to end rotating. The victorious bets are based on the positioning in which the baseball places on wheel.
